3. Setup Guide

3.1 Initial Setup

  1. Charge the Doorbell: Before first use, fully charge the doorbell using the provided Micro USB cable. The 10000 mAh rechargeable battery ensures long-lasting performance.

  3. Download the App: Search for the "Bextgoo" app (or specified app name if available, otherwise generic) on Google Play Store or Apple App Store and install it on your smartphone.
  4. Pair the Doorbell: Follow the in-app instructions to pair your doorbell with your Wi-Fi network and smartphone. Ensure your Wi-Fi signal is strong at the installation location.
  5. Install Chime Batteries: Insert the 3 AAA batteries into the wireless chime.

3.2 Installation

The doorbell is designed for easy installation, typically within 3 minutes.

  1. Choose Location: Select a suitable outdoor location near your door, ensuring good Wi-Fi coverage.
  2. Mounting: Use the provided screw kits and tools to securely mount the doorbell to the wall.
  3. Final Check: Verify the doorbell is firmly attached and test its functionality via the app.

4. Operating Instructions

4.1 2K FHD Resolution & Night Vision

The doorbell provides 2K/4MP FHD resolution for clear images day and night. Its infrared night vision offers crystal-clear details up to 15 meters (50 feet), enhancing security. The 170° wide-angle lens ensures comprehensive coverage.

4.2 AI Human Detection

Equipped with AI-powered human motion detection, the doorbell significantly reduces false alerts by up to 95%, focusing only on relevant events. You can customize detection zones and sensitivity settings within the app.

4.3 Two-Way Audio & Voice Message

Communicate with visitors in real-time using the built-in speaker and microphone. The doorbell also supports pre-recorded voice messages (0-10 seconds) for quick responses when you're busy.

4.4 Anti-Theft Alarm

The integrated anti-theft system automatically records video and sends notifications if someone attempts to remove the device, providing an additional layer of security.

4.5 IP67 Waterproof Rating

The doorbell is built with high-quality materials and boasts an IP67 dust and water resistance rating, allowing it to withstand various extreme weather conditions from -35°C to 60°C (-31°F to 140°F).

4.6 Storage Options

The wireless doorbell supports both local memory cards (up to 128GB, not included) and Cloud storage (with a 7-day free trial) for video storage.

5. Maintenance

  • Cleaning: Wipe the doorbell's exterior with a soft, damp cloth. Do not use har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ners.
  • Battery Charging: Recharge the doorbell battery when indicated by the app or low battery indicator. The 10000 mAh battery provides extended usage, but regular charging is recommended for optimal performance.
  • Firmware Updates: Regularly check the app for firmware updates to ensure your doorbell has the latest features and security enhancements.

6. Troubleshooting

ProblemPossible Cause / Solution
Doorbell not connecting to Wi-Fi
  • Ensure your Wi-Fi network is 2.4GHz.
  • Check Wi-Fi signal strength at the doorbell's location.
  • Restart your router and the doorbell.
  • Re-attempt pairing through the app.
Short battery life
  • Frequent motion detection events can drain the battery faster. Adjust sensitivity or detection zones.
  • Ensure the doorbell is fully charged each time.
  • Extreme temperatures can affect battery performance.
No motion detection alerts
  • Check motion detection settings in the app (sensitivity, zones).
  • Ensure notifications are enabled on your phone and in the app.
  • Verify the doorbell has power and is connected to Wi-Fi.
Poor video quality
  • Check your Wi-Fi signal strength. A weak signal can degrade video quality.
  • Clean the camera lens if it's dirty or obstructed.

7. Specifications

FeatureDetail
Model NumberP4
Video Recording Resolution1440p (2K FHD)
Effective Video Resolution1440
Battery Capacity10000 mAh (Lithium-ion)
Wireless Communication TechnologyWi-Fi (2.4GHz)
Viewing Angle170 degrees
Night Vision Range20 Meters (65 feet)
Frame Rate30 frames per second
Waterproof RatingIP67
Operating Temperature-35°C to 60°C (-31°F to 140°F)
Storage OptionsLocal (up to 128GB SD card, not included), Cloud Storage
MaterialPlastic
Dimensions (L x W x H)14 x 12 x 4 cm
Weight620 grams
